Serge has carved out a distinguished niche in the commercial real estate sector, expertly navigating the intricacies of property acquisitions, developments, and leasing across Alberta and British Columbia. His reputation is built on orchestrating some of Canada's landmark leasing deals, showcasing his unparalleled skill in sealing complex agreements.

In the realm of project financing, Serge is the go-to expert for negotiating terms that benefit his clients, ensuring their financial interests are safeguarded and maximized. He brings a meticulous eye to drafting and reviewing leases for commercial, industrial, office spaces, and shopping centres, making sure every clause serves his client's best interests. Serge's proficiency extends to municipal planning, where he adeptly handles subdivision approvals and zoning issues, smoothing the path for project development.

His legal acumen also includes crafting lender security documents such as mortgages, a critical aspect of concluding financial transactions tied to real estate. Serge's client roster is impressive, featuring work with leading multinational technology companies and national grocery chains, underscoring his trusted advisor status in high-stakes negotiations.

Noteworthy in his portfolio is his role in the Canada Pension Plan's monumental $1-billion acquisition of Oxford Property Group assets. This deal, which spanned across major Canadian cities, involved securing a 50% interest in prime office properties, demonstrating Serge's capacity to handle transactions of significant scale and complexity. Furthermore, Serge's expertise facilitated a group of corporations in acquiring assets from subsidiaries of General Electric, a transaction nearing the $1 billion mark and spanning across North America.

Serge is also at the forefront of legal thought leadership, offering insights into critical issues like the Canada Emergency Rent Subsidy (CERS) program, the implications of force majeure clauses during the COVID-19 pandemic, and updates on the Land Owner Transparency Act (LOTA). His contributions help clients navigate the evolving legal landscape, especially in challenging times.

Beyond his professional achievements, Serge is an active participant in the legal and real estate communities, holding memberships with the Canadian Bar Association, the Calgary Bar Association, the National Association of Industrial and Office Properties, and the Urban Development Institute. His contributions to the field of property leasing have been recognized in The Canadian Legal Lexpert Directory and The Best Lawyers in Canada®, marking him as a leading figure in commercial leasing law.

Admitted to the bar in Alberta and British Columbia, Serge's educational background includes an LLB from the University of Saskatchewan and a BBA from Simon Fraser University. His journey from business to law has equipped him with a unique perspective, enhancing his ability to craft solutions that are not only legally sound but also commercially viable.
